Can flooring truly be waterproof?

Waterproof flooring is designed to withstand exposure to water without damage. Unlike water-resistant flooring, which can handle minor spills and splashes, waterproof flooring is built to endure standing water and significant moisture exposure. This makes it an excellent choice for areas where spills, humidity, and even floods might occur.

Types of waterproof flooring

Several types of flooring are marketed as waterproof. The most popular options include:

  1. Luxury vinyl flooring (LVF): This is one of the most resilient and stylish waterproof flooring options. LVF can mimic the look of hardwood, stone, or tile, providing a versatile and durable solution for any room.
  2. Tile flooring: Both ceramic and porcelain tiles are naturally waterproof and highly durable. They are ideal for bathrooms, kitchens, and laundry rooms due to their ability to repel water and resist stains.
  3. Waterproof laminate: Advances in technology have led to the development of waterproof laminate flooring. It combines the beauty of wood with a waterproof core, making it a great choice for various areas in the home.
  4. Waterproof carpet: Yes, you read that right! Some carpets are designed with waterproof backing and stain-resistant fibers, making them suitable for basements and family rooms where spills are common.

The benefits of waterproof flooring

Choosing waterproof flooring offers several advantages:

  • Durability: Waterproof flooring is designed to handle high levels of moisture without warping, swelling, or developing mold and mildew.
  • Ease of maintenance: Waterproof flooring is generally easy to clean and maintain. Spills can be wiped up without fear of damage, and regular cleaning routines are straightforward.
  • Versatility: With a variety of styles, colors, and materials available, waterproof flooring can complement any décor and be used throughout the home.

Can waterproof flooring truly be waterproof?

While waterproof flooring is highly resistant to water, it's essential to understand that no flooring can guarantee 100% protection against all types of water damage. For example, severe flooding or prolonged exposure to water can potentially harm any flooring material. However, when properly installed and maintained, waterproof flooring provides an exceptional level of protection and performance in areas where moisture is a concern.
